I found my own answer on www2.hp.com. The paper specification 106-163 g/m2 refers to paper weight.
120g/m2 equals 32-pound bond paper
160g/m2 equals 42-pound bond paper
Once paper gets over 24 pound its must be some specility paper (Photo) based on the printer requirements. 100 pound bond paper is card stock. SO look closely at the printer properties.
